> Parliamentwatch.org is launching a platform in Ireland, allowing citizens to
> publicly pose questions to the parlament´s candidates.
> Questions and answers are, after they are moderated according to our code of
> conduct, saved in the online archive and available to the public.
>
> Parliamentwatch strives for more transparency in politics and stronger
> citizen participation.
> In Germany we have already been operating a platform at
> www.abgeordnetenwatch.de since 2004.
>
> As we want to allow the Irish citizens to ask questions to their members of
> parliament, we are in need of an API with all the members of the Dáil.
> I was wondering whether an API exists that features the candidates of the
> Irish parliament (the Dáil) and whether anyone could provide me with such an
> API or knows where I could find it?
